Here are some details about the criminal case filed against Chad Doerman in 2010 after he choked his father. Charges were dismissed when the father did not appear in court.

"However, the Cincinnati Enquirer reported Friday that Chad once choked his father — in 2010.

The case ultimately was dismissed, apparently after the alleged victim — identified as his father Keith — failed to appear as a prosecution witness, the outlet reported.

The elder Doerman was 46 at the time the charges were filed in July 2010. Chad Doerman pleaded not guilty to domestic violence on July 26, 2010, docket filings show. The case was dismissed on Aug. 26 of that year.

“That was not true,” Keith Doerman told The Post. “The story was wrong and the judge dismissed the case.”

Doerman said he did not want to elaborate further and began crying.

“I can’t think right now,” he said and hung up the phone."
